    As many of us know, Veterans Stadium in Philadelphia, which hosted Eagles and Phillies games for some 33 years, was torn down last weekend.

    Being from Philly myself, this was quite emotional for me, seeing as that I had many memories of the vet, from when I was a kid to the second to last baseball game played there. Do you have any memories at the vet?

    When I was younger, my father would take me every other weekend to Phillies games on the subway. The train all the way to the stadium would be packed with excited fans, and the stadium was sometimes a riot scene. Those were the good times...
